Planeta is undoubtedly Sicily’s leading wine producer. Founded in 1985, this dynamic winery is responsible for championing both indigenous and international grape varieties and pioneering the development of high-quality wine on the island. The Brancaia estate as we know it, celebrates its 40th birthday this year. Swiss couple Brigitte and Bruno Widmer purchased Brancaia in Castellina in Chianti in 1981 and their wines have been critically praised from the start.
